Cryptocurrency can feel abstract at first. It’s digital, decentralized, and doesn’t exist in physical form like cash. So how does it actually get its value—and why are investors in Charlotte paying attention?

Blockchain might sound like a complicated tech buzzword, but at its core, it’s actually a simple concept. Think of it as a digital ledger—a record book—that stores information in a way that is secure, transparent, and extremely difficult to alter. Instead of being controlled by a single central authority, blockchain records are distributed across a network of computers, which helps prevent fraud and manipulation.
